Because the IPv4 address space is commonly used around the world, most ISP are turning to 'carrier grade NAT' where customers share the overall scope of intellectual to a NAT upstream.  The reputation of the internet of such middlebox will trend down in the most infected client / badly behaved behind it, which is always going to be a zombie botnet.  Could collateral damage to the protocols used by perfectly well-behaved clients that also share the catwalk of the GNC.

During this time, you can not new the regional internet registrys IPv4 subnets, so your only effective source of additional IP space is to pay for a transfer to someone else.  The transferred subnet was probably already in use and so can be on blacklists to email spamming or have blackhole routes to the backbone of the ISP.  He could have previously also housed nuisance attractive such as banking or services of Paris that are often being DDOSd because of the inertia of the miscreant.  This can take time and effort to clean.

Recycled IPv4 addresses that are actually working for you are not particularly more at risk than the addresses of archaic origin question from a security point of view; mainly, endpoint software quality-controlled not by mere reputation.

Sort of.  The usual problem is that a client v6 only (say, a cellphone LTE4) tries to join a v4 service only (for example, a typical business web site).  This requires 6--> 4 translation; for that this week the default mechanism seems to be "464xlat".  The customer gets two v6/64 prefixes, transport v6 only and a private address v4 which is in tunnel on the secondary prefix to a carrier grade NAT64/DNS64 middlebox.

The inverse problem of a customer only v4 trying to reach the Server v6 only is usually academic; usually you dual-stack to the client instead and there aren't many services only v6, although this will change.

The IETF has downgraded RFC 2766 NAT - PT for the translation of v4 to v6 historical belonging, meaning it is not recommended for use on the internet in general, in the RFC 4966.  In addition to all the usual problems of NAT, NAT - PT does not work across ISPS due to the inability to get the right DNS46 TTL values.  If you try only translate a small subnet of a single body, say a v4/24, you might be able to find a software that did it, but it's the wrong way to take.

If the problem is that the customer support not double stack v4 + v6, switch to something produced in this century; even windows XP can be dual-Stack if offer you it DNS on v4.

If the problem is the ISP offer v6-transport, tunnel traffic v4 across this gap v6 to a double gateway to battery.

    What is the best way to deny IP selected inside the addresses (PCs) access to the internet router in a PIX 506? Thank you

    Lori a

    Just use an ACL on your inside interface like so (this arretera.100 et.101 hosts out):

    > access-list out refuse host ip 192.168.1.100 everything

    > access-list out refuse host ip 192.168.1.101 everything

    > outgoing access-list allow ip 192.168.1.0 255.255.255.0 any

    > Access-group out in the interface inside

    In addition, you can change the following:

    > global (outside) 1 205.238.220.19 - 205.238.220.22

    > nat (inside) 1 0.0.0.0 0.0.0.0 0 0

    TO:

    > global (outside) 1 205.238.220.19 - 205.238.220.21

    > global (outside) 1 205.238.220.22

    > nat (inside) 1 0.0.0.0 0.0.0.0 0 0

    cause what you will allow only 4 outgoing sessions, only one user can use up to go to a web page. The second version will be PAT connections using the adresse.22, which will give you a 65 000 or if additional connections coming out.
